Description
A classic all metal antique with good parts support and many owners around the world. A comfortable and stable cruising aircraft. Original art deco paint finish make it a notable arrival. Sale is due to loss of medical. This aircraft was imported around 1979 and restored at Moorabbin Airport. It arrived in the country with a newly overhauled engine and after-market airframe and wings corrosion proofing. Full documentation of the aircraft prior to arrival in Australia and of the restoration. Always hangared in Australia. Low engine hours (432 hrs SMOH). After recent replacement of gaskets and seals, top end overhaul and big end bearings replacement, a bulk strip was done, the reasons for which will be explained to an interested buyer. The engine has completed about 20 hours since the re-build and passed inspection, oil use and cylinder pressure test. Annual Inspection late December 2025. "Flip flop" Radio. Space for transponder.
